WARNING: CONGESTIVE HEART FAILURE See full prescribing information for complete boxed warning Thiazolidinediones, including pioglitazone, cause orexacerbate congestive heart failure in some patients., After initiation of OSENI and after dose increases, monitorpatients carefully for signs and symptoms of heart failure (e.g., excessive, rapid weight gain, dyspnea, and/or edema). If heart failure develops, it should be managed according to current standards of care and discontinuation or dose reduction of pioglitazone in OSENI must be considered., OSENI is not recommended in patients with symptomatic heart failure., Initiation of OSENI in patients with established New York Heart Association (NYHA) Class III or IV heart failure is contraindicated. Before you start taking Oseni, tell your doctor:, About any medications you take, including prescription, over-the-counter, vitamins, and supplements, About any health conditions you have, If you are pregnant or plan to become pregnant, If you are breastfeeding or plan to breastfeed, Oseni can worsen or cause congestive heart failure. Tell your doctor if you have trouble breathing with activity or when lying down, fatigue, weakness, swelling in the abdomen, legs, ankles, and feet, abnormal heart beat, a cough that won't go away, rapid weight gain, nausea, no appetite, problems concentrating, or chest pain., Oseni can cause acute pancreatitis. Seek medical care right away if you develop pain in your abdomen, pain that radiates from your abdomen to your back, tenderness of the abdomen, fever, quickened pulse, nausea, and vomiting., Oseni can cause liver problems that can sometimes be fatal., Oseni can cause swelling., Oseni can increase the risk for fractures in female patients., Oseni can increase the risk for bladder cancer. If you have a history of bladder cancer, caution should be used. Do not take Oseni if you have active bladder cancer., Low blood sugar can occur when taking Oseni with insulin or other medications that can also lower your blood sugar. Monitor for signs of low blood sugar and treat your low blood sugar as your doctor has instructed., Tell your doctor if you experience vision problems while taking Oseni.
